Elden Ring Bloodhound's Fang is a Curved Greatsword Weapon that inflicts Physical Damage in the form of Slash Attacks with the ability to use the Unique Skill (Bloodhound's Finesse). Bloodhound's Fang will require Strength 18, Dexterity 17, and scales based on Strength D, Dexterity C, Stats.
Description: Curved greatsword with a gently undulating blade wielded by Bloodhound Knights. A fearsome blade capable of brutal airborne attacks.

| Skill | Type | FP Cost |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bloodhound's Finesse | Unique | 8 / 12 | Slash upwards with the Bloodhound's Fang, using the momentum of the strike to perform a backwards somersault and gain some distance from foes. Follow up with a strong attack to perform the Bloodhound's Step attack. |

Where To Find Bloodhound's Fang Location in Elden Ring
Drop from the Bloodhound Knight Darriwil found in Forlorn Hound Evergaol. Once you win the fight, Bloodhound's Fang is a guaranteed reward.

Max +10 with Somber Smithing Stones. Bloodhound's Fang keeps Bloodhound's Finesse permanently, no Ash of War swaps. The upside? Greases and spell buffs apply normally, giving you a free damage boost.
| Level | Material | Rune Cost |
|---|---|---|
| +1 | Somber Smithing Stone [1] | 640 Runes |
| +2 | Somber Smithing Stone [2] | 960 Runes |
| +3 | Somber Smithing Stone [3] | 1,280 Runes |
| +4 | Somber Smithing Stone [4] | 1,600 Runes |
| +5 | Somber Smithing Stone [5] | 1,920 Runes |
| +6 | Somber Smithing Stone [6] | 2,240 Runes |
| +7 | Somber Smithing Stone [7] | 2,560 Runes |
| +8 | Somber Smithing Stone [8] | 2,880 Runes |
| +9 | Somber Smithing Stone [9] | 3,200 Runes |
| +10 | Somber Ancient Dragon Smithing Stone | 3,840 Runes |
| Total | All Levels | 21,120 Runes |
